The Colon constitutes the principal tract of the large intestines, and exceeds them all in diameter: as accumulations in its cavity frequently produce various ill effects from their pressure, it becomes essential for the practitioner to know its direction and bearings. It commences in the cavity of the os ilium, on the right side; from thence, ascending by the kidney on the same side, it passes under the concave side of the liver, to which it is sometimes tied, as also to the gallbladder, which tinges it yellow in that place'; it then runs under the bottom of the stomach to the spleen, in the left side, to which it is also affixed; and thence, passing in the form of the Greek letter 2, it terminates in the upper part of the os sacrum in the rectum. It appears, therefore, to be contiguous to all the digestive organs, and may consequently produce much disturbance by its morbid distention. Its connexion with the duodenum is also a circumstance of much pathological importance: whatever motion takes place in the former intestine will be communicated, more or less, to the latter; and should it become unnaturally distended, it will press immediately upon the ascending part of the duodenum, and retard the progress of the alimentary matter, which has always to rise against gravity, when the body is in an erect position, or recumbent on the right side.

The colon has been divided into the ascending portion, which extends from the coecum to the right hypochondrium; into the transverse portion, or what is termed its great arch; and into the descending portion, including what has been called its sigmoid flexure. The coats of this intestine are much stronger than those of the others: its muscular layer has also a peculiar disposition; its longitudinal fibres form three straight bundles or bands, far separated from each other when the intestine is dilated; at the same time, its circular fibres form bands, equally separated from each other, but more numerous: from which arrangement it follows, that, in a great number of places, the intestine only consists of the peritonaeum and its mucous membrane; these places are generally formed into distinct cavities, which have been termed the cells of the colon: they serve to promote a gradual descent of the excrement; but, when the action of the canal is torpid, they give origin to much mischief, by unduly retaining its contents.

25. Several physiologists have supposed that the colon performs some other function than that of a mere recipient. Sir E. Home imagined that it formed fat; an hypothesis which would have received some slight support from the fact that the fattest animals have generally the largest colons, did we not know that persons have lived, and enjoyed good health, for many years, with an artificial anus formed by the coecal extremity of the small intestines, which sufficiently proves that the large intestines are not essential to perfect digestion, nor to the maintenance of life.

The rectum is the last portion of the intestinal canal; it begins at the upper part of the os sacrum, where the colon ends, and going straight down (whence its name), it is tied to the extremities of the coccyx by the peritonaeum behind, and to the neck of the bladder in men, but in women to the vagina uteri before; whence arises the sympathy between those parts. The coats of the rectum are more thick and fleshy than those of any other of the intestines: it has not in general any valves, but several rugae; had the former existed, the expulsion of the faeces would have suffered inconvenient delay. The figure of the rectum varies, as it is full or empty; when empty, it is regularly cylindrical, and contracts in transverse folds: it is capable of very great distention, and may even be extended to the size of a large bladder: the quantity of faeces that sometimes accumulates is prodigious, and cannot be removed except by mechanical means.
